187 combat clashes reported on Russia-Ukraine frontline, Russian troops drop 19 KABs in Kursk region

On September 26, 187 combat clashes were reported along the frontline, with the most intense fighting occurring in the Pokrovsk sector. The Russian army was also active in the Kurakhove sector

This is stated in the report of the Ukrainian General Staff as of 8:00 a.m. on September 27.

Over the past day, 187 combat clashes were registered. 

According to updated information, on September 26, the Russian army launched five strikes with eight missiles and 71 air strikes against Ukrainian units and settlements, deploying 96 KABs. They also fired more than 4,800 rounds, including 224 from multiple launch rocket systems.

Russia carried out air strikes near 15 settlements in Sumy region; 5 in Kharkiv region; 11 in Donetsk region; 2 in Zaporizhzhia region and 1 in Kherson region.

Yesterday, Ukraine's aviation, missile forces and artillery conducted four strikes on Russian personnel and weapons concentrations.

Frontline update

In the Kharkiv direction, three firefights took place near Starytsia, Tykhe and Vovchansk.

In the Kupyansk direction, there were 20 combat clashes. Ukrainian Defense Forces repelled Russia's assaults near Synkivka, Hlushkivka, Lozova, Stelmakhivka and Kolisnykivka.

There were 15 combat clashes in the Lyman direction. Russian troops attacked near Hrekivka, Nevske, Novosadove and Torske.

Four battles took place in the Siversk direction. Ukrainian forces stopped all Russia's attempts to break through the defense near Bilohorivka, Verkhniokamianske and Spirne.

There were 10 firefights in the Kramatorsk direction. Ukrainian defenders repelled Russian assault operations near Minkivka, Hryhorivka and Bila Hora.

In the Toretsk direction, 18 combat clashes took place, in particular, near Toretsk, Shcherbynivka and Leonidivka.

In the Pokrovsk direction, Ukrainian defenders repulsed 42 Russian assaults in the areas of 8 settlements. The highest concentration of attacks was near Selydove and Marynivka.

In the Kurakhove direction, the Ukrainian Armed Forces stopped 36 Russian attacks near 7 settlements.

In the Vremivka direction, Russian invaders conducted five offensives near Vodiane, Katerynivka and Bohoyavlenka.

Three firefights took place in the Orikhiv direction. Ukrainian defenders rebuffed Russia's attacks near Robotyne.

In the Prydniprovskyi direction, the occupying Russian forces also suffered defeats, attacking the Ukrainian defensive lines twice.

The situation in the Huliaipole direction remained unchanged.

On the border with Belarus, no signs of Russian offensive groups formation were detected.

On the border with Chernihiv and Sumy regions, Russia is actively using guided aerial bombs and attack UAVs, conducting mortar and artillery shelling of Ukrainian settlements.

Russian KABs are also detonating in the Kursk region, where Ukrainian troops are conducting operations. Reports indicate that Russia carried out 16 air strikes over the past day, utilizing 19 KABs.

At the same time, the Ukrainian soldiers continue to inflict significant losses in manpower and equipment on the occupying Russian forces, depleting the Russian a armylong the entire frontline.
